Base Cabinet Configurations for ZS5-4 Racked System Performance Configurations

ZS5-4 Racked System maximum performance configurations require four SAS-3 HBAs, which provide the maximum of 16 ports of SAS-3 HBA connectivity.

The SAS-3 HBA port numbering order is ascending, from bottom (Port 0) to top (Port 3). Both SAS-3 HBA cards and DE3-24 disk shelves use the SFF 8644 connectors.

The ZS5-4 Racked System performance configurations follow standard cabling methodologies with additional restrictions that allow use of the cable management arm (CMA). They provide a more practical implementation for SSD log device and read cache device matching, limited multi-cabinet expansion, and can be configured for maximum or optimal performance.

Any upgrades that change the number of SAS-3 HBA cards, or include more than one cabinet that is not an original ZS5-4 Racked System or not compatible with ZS5-4 Racked System must be re-cabled for that particular configuration.
